Americanisation programs were predicated on the notion that Indigenous peoples would be able to peacefully integrate with the majority of society after they absorbed the traditions and values of the United States.
What did Americanization mean to Native Americans?Between the 1790s and the 1920s, a number of initiatives were made in the United States of America to integrate Native Americans into the country's dominant European-American culture. The first Americans to execute Native American cultural integration in an American environment were George Washington and Henry Knox. The primary strategy for assisting minorities in their assimilation was thought to be education.
The federal government outlawed the performance of traditional religious rites after the end of the Indian Wars in the late 19th and early 20th centuries. Children were compelled to attend Native American boarding schools, which were constructed. They were compelled to speak English, take core classes, go to church, and renounce their tribal customs while attending these institutions.

George W. Bush's popularity declined because inspectors found no weapons of mass destruction in Iraq. This discovery undermined the justification for the Iraq War and raised questions about the accuracy of the intelligence used to support the invasion.
During George W. Bush's presidency, the United States led a military intervention in Iraq based on the belief that Iraq possessed weapons of mass destruction (WMDs). However, after the invasion, inspections conducted by international bodies such as the United Nations found no evidence of these weapons. This discovery had significant implications for President Bush's popularity and public perception of the Iraq War.
The absence of weapons of mass destruction undermined the primary justification given for the invasion. The American public had been led to believe that Iraq posed an immediate threat to national security due to its alleged possession of WMDs. The failure to find any such weapons eroded public trust in the decision-making process and raised questions about the accuracy of the intelligence that had been used to support the invasion.

Former President Donald Trump's appointments of Neil Gorsuch, Brett Kavanaugh, and Amy Coney Barrett to the Supreme Court have had and will continue to have a significant impact on the court.
These appointments have shifted the balance of the court to a more conservative majority, potentially influencing the direction of future legal decisions.
Neil Gorsuch: Gorsuch was appointed by President Trump in 2017 to fill the vacancy left by the death of Justice Antonin Scalia. Gorsuch is considered a conservative judge who emphasizes textualism and originalism in his interpretation of the Constitution. His appointment restored the ideological balance on the court following Scalia's passing.
Brett Kavanaugh: Kavanaugh's appointment in 2018 was contentious and marked by intense public scrutiny during his confirmation hearings. Kavanaugh's judicial record suggests he leans conservative, although he has also demonstrated an independent streak in some cases. His appointment solidified the conservative majority on the court, potentially influencing its decisions on a range of issues.
Amy Coney Barrett: Barrett's appointment in 2020 was also met with significant attention and controversy. As a conservative jurist, she is expected to interpret the Constitution in a textualist and originalist manner, similar to Justice Gorsuch. Her appointment further solidified the conservative majority on the court, potentially shaping its rulings for years to come.

What is mexico Economy like?
Answer:
The economy of Mexico is a developing market economy. It is the 15th largest in the world in nominal GDP terms and the 11th largest by purchasing power parity, according to the International Monetary Fund. Since the 1994 crisis, administrations have improved the country's macroeconomic fundamentals
